I’m borrowing some thoughts from a blurb I saw of Alistair Begg recently, and it spoke volumes to my heart, and I pray that it will reach hearts, minds, and souls today.
Alistair was talking about how we get into heaven, and he talked about the thief on the cross at heaven’s gate: he couldn’t pass a theology test, he couldn’t quote the doctrinal statement of his church, he couldn’t pass a biblical knowledge test, but when asked ‘why he should get to come into heaven’ he simply replied, “the man on the middle cross said I could come”! It’s all about Jesus! It’s not your/my credentials that get us into heaven; it’s not our “love” for God and country; it’s not our good works in the church, the community, or our governmental service! It’s only through the blood of The Lamb of God who came to pay for our sin. Only when we look to the cross in repentance and faith will we find salvation and the right to a place in heaven.
